    I just put together a PC system running on Windows 10 w/ 16gb RAM using Adobe Premier Pro CC. I have a Sony HDR A1U Video camera that records to mini dv tape. So I shoot a little project and I’m capturing the footage to the PC no problem till I go to playback and I have skipping video and audio dropouts. I set up the capture on “same as project” settings. The video card was integrated with the motherboard so then I purchased a NVIDIA GeForce GT 740 2gb and still the issue remains. Is it in my settings, software or hardware? Open to suggestions short of a new camera.

    First thing – any chance your footage was shot at the LP speed instead of SP? LP speed was a dirty little secret of miniDV. The dirty little secret was folks had a lot of problems with it, even if the capture was from the original camera.
